Diethyltoluamide (DEET) is the most common active ingredient in insect repellents. It is intended to provide protection against mosquitoes, ticks, fleas, chiggers, leeches, and many other biting insects. Diethyltoluamide is toxic to hepatocytes and can lead to many physiological, pharmacological, and behavioral abnormalities, particularly motor deficits and learning and memory dysfunction .

Picaridin (Lcaridin) is a broad spectrum arthropod repellent. Picaridin interacts with mosquito and tick olfactory receptor proteins. Picaridin repels Aedes aegypti. Picaridin exhibits considerable antibacterial, anticandidal and antifungal properties .

Insect repellent M 3535 (Ethyl butylacetylaminopropionate) is a broad-spectrum, mild insect repellent based on the structure of β-alanine. Insect repellent M 3535 exerts repellent effects by interfering with the olfaction of mosquitoes, but it poses risks of developmental and cardiac toxicity to aquatic organisms such as zebrafish embryos in aquatic environments, and can activate oxidative stress responses .

1,4-Dichlorobenzene is a non-genotoxic, orally active mitogenic/tumor-promoting carcinogen that is also widely used as a dye, resin intermediate, and deodorant, moth repellent/insecticide. 1,4-Dichlorobenzene induces liver tumors in mice and promotes the growth of spontaneous precancerous lesions, but shows no liver tumor-inducing activity in F344 rats. Exposure to 1,4-dichlorobenzene leads to elevated leukocyte counts, serum alanine aminotransferase, and blood urea nitrogen levels. Due to the hepatotoxic characteristics, 1,4-Dichlorobenzene is applicable to liver cancer-related research .

Veratraldehyde is an orally active aromatic compound and antibacterial agent. Veratraldehyde can be isolated from essential oils of plants such as peppermint and ginger. Veratraldehyde targets the PilY1 protein. Veratraldehyde has antibacterial activity against Pseudomonas aeruginosa. Veratraldehyde has a repellent effect against mosquitoes and ticks. Veratraldehyde can be used as a flavoring agent .

Vanillyl butyl ether is a major contributor to the characteristic flavor and fragrance of vanilla. Vanillyl butyl ether is one of the eco-friendly and nontoxic substances. Vanillyl butyl ether exhibits mutually inhibitory effects on mammalian TRPV1 and TRPM8 channels. Vanillyl butyl ether shows repellency activity against Tribolium castaneum, T. confusum and L. bostrychophila. Vanillyl butyl ether acts as a mild warming agent, providing a warming sensation and enhancing blood circulation .

Benzylacetone (4-Penylbutan-2-one) is an aromatic compound. Benzylacetone is a mushroom tyrosinase inhibitor with an IC50 of 2.8 mM, a Ki of 1.25 mM for monophenolase and an IC50 of 0.6 mM, a Ki of 0.39 mM for diphenolase. Benzylacetone inhibits free mushroom tyrosinase and enzyme-substrate complex. Benzylacetone acts as an appetite enhancer via olfactory stimulation, reduces spontaneous locomotor activity, induces weight gain. Benzylacetone exhibits repellent, fumigant, and contact toxicity against Tribolium castaneum adults .

Ascr#9 is a small-molecule pheromone belonging to the ascaroside family, and it is widely present in nematodes. Ascr#9 promotes dispersal or elicits avoidance behavior in various nematode species (such as Caenorhabditis elegans and entomopathogenic nematodes), suggesting that individuals evacuate from adverse environments. Ascr#9 exhibits repellent potential in Meloidogyne incognita .

Prallethrin, a spatial mosquito repellent, is a non-fluorinated pyrethroid targeting lung surfactant proteins (SPs). prallethrin has vapor toxicity and can bind with the lung SPs by hydrogen and hydrophobic interactions, impairing functions of SPs. Prallethrin can be used for respiratory illness, pathogenic infections and malignancy research .

Cyetpyrafen is a pyrazole insecticide/acaricide with broad-spectrum insecticidal activity. Cyetpyrafen binds to DhelOBP4 (Ki = 4.95 μM) and DhelOBP21 (Ki = 5.51 μM) to mediate olfactory recognition in *Cryptolaemus montrouzieri*. Cyetpyrafen induces dose-dependent electroantennogram responses in *Cryptolaemus montrouzieri* and exhibits repellent effects on the species. Cyetpyrafen has bioaccumulative properties, is rapidly and passively absorbed by the roots of lettuce and rice, reaches a steady state within 24 h, preferentially accumulates in roots, and shows limited xylem/phloem translocation .
